Account of Public Expenditures, 31 August 1803

Account of Public Expenditures

Expenditures on the Streets in July 1803
Overseers & Labourers wages in June $763.71
 Lumber for trunks &c 53.58
Ironmongery, Blacksmiths work & other small articles 40.94
$858.23
Expenditures on Streets in August 1803
For Overseers & Labourers wages $672.41
Lumber for bridges & trunks 54.77
Carpenters work on Do. 109.92
Bricklayers Do. on Do. and } 64.77
Bricks & Lime for an Arch
Ds. 901.87
Expenditures on the Capitol in July 1803
For Lime & hauling it to the building $267.66
Mason, Carpenters & Labourers wages for June 828.59
Foundation Stone & hauling it (on Acct.) 662.75
Sand 104.40
 
Nails 46.55
Lumber 171.40
George Blagdin for freestone work, on acct, 1,500   
H. B. Latrobe for Salary & materials to be } 641.66
   Accounted for
Sundry small articles 21.75
Ds 4,244.76
Expenditures on Capitol in August 1803
Wages of Masons, Carpenters, Labourers &c
      for month of July—*
} $1024.92
George Blagdin on Acct. freestone work 2,000.00
Cordage 81.45
Putlogs 10.50
Oznaburgs 37.27
$3,154.14
Foundation Stone 240.08
roll Labourers (omitted in the above*) 564.33
$3,958.55

N.B. the wages of workmen & Labourers for August are not included in the above the rolls not being returned—some small payts. on Acct. have been made

Expenditures on the Presidents house in July & August 1803
For Well $117.40
reparing pump 16.33
Hardware 102.32
Lead 201.30
Plaistering 80.50
Lumber 156.24
Stone at north front door & Cutting it 5.33
Ds  679.42

MS (DLC); undated, entirely in Munroe’s hand.
